"Jacob Faithful, draw near," were the first words which struck upon my
tympanum the next morning, when I had taken my seat at the further end
of the school-room. I rose and threaded my way through two lines of
boys, who put out their legs to trip me up in my passage through their
ranks; and surmounting all difficulties, found myself within three feet
of the master's high desk, or pulpit, from which he looked down upon me
like the Olympian Jupiter upon mortals, in ancient time.
"Jacob Faithful, canst thou read?"
"No, I can't," replied I; "I wish I could."
"A well-disposed answer, Jacob; thy wishes shall be gratified. Knowest
thou thine alphabet?"
"I don't know what that is."
"Then thou knowest it not. Mr Knapps shall forthwith instruct thee.
Thou shall forthwith go to Mr Knapps, who inculcateth the rudiments.
_Levior Puer_, lighter-boy, thou hast a _crafty_ look." And then I
heard a noise in his throat that resembled the "cluck, cluck" when my
poor mother poured the gin out of the great stone bottle.
"My little navilculator," continued he, "thou art a weed washed on
shore, one of Father Thames' cast-up wrecks. `_Fluviorum rex
Eridanus_,' [Chuck, cluck.] To thy studies; be thyself--that is, be
Faithful. Mr Knapps, let the Cadmean art proceed forthwith." So
